So we just found out today that my bro-in-law (and our current basement dweller) Scott Jensen got word that he has a Wild Card for the WSBK event at Miller Motorsports Park. At this stage he is the ONLY American that has been offered a wildcard for the event 8)

Doing the WSBK event along with the AMA SBK/Superstock races comes with it's own list of logistical headaches, like since his AMA SBK is also his WSBK the wheels and tires from one event cant go anywhere near the the other area. It's to do with the control tire setup, he cant use his US tires for the WSBK or the WSBK tires for the AMA event.

The schedule for him is nuts as well, he is on track for almost 7 hours on Saturday and will have the AMA SBK #1 race, back to back with the AMA Superstock race, back to back with WSBK Superpole if he makes top 16 cutoff. On Sunday he has WSBK #1, then AMA #2, then WSBK #2, then we get drunk
